The Role:
The CMM Programmer is responsible for developing, validating, and executing inspection programs using Coordinate Measuring Machines (CMM) to ensure precision components meet engineering specifications and quality standards. This role supports manufacturing, engineering, and quality teams in a fast-paced aerospace/industrial environment.
- Develop and optimize CMM programs (e.g., PC-DMIS, Calypso) for complex components
- Interpret engineering drawings, GD&T, and customer specifications
- Perform first article inspections (FAI) and in-process inspections
- Analyze inspection data and generate detailed reports
- Troubleshoot measurement issues and improve inspection processes
- Collaborate with engineering and production teams to resolve quality concerns
- Maintain calibration and proper functioning of CMM equipment
- Support continuous improvement and lean manufacturing initiatives

If you have any of the below skills, we would love to talk to you about your next career move:
- Associate’s or Bachelor’s degree in Manufacturing, Engineering, or related field (or equivalent experience)
- 3+ years of CMM programming experience
- Strong understanding of GD&T and blueprint reading
- Experience with CMM software (PC-DMIS, Zeiss Calypso, or similar)
- Knowledge of aerospace quality standards (AS9100 preferred)
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
